Existing API updates
- Invoices API (beta)
- InvoiceStatus enum. Added the
PAYMENT_PENDINGvalue. Previously, the Invoices API returned aPAIDorPARTIALLY_PAIDstatus for invoices in a payment pending state. Now, the Invoices API returns aPAYMENT_PENDINGstatus for all invoices in a payment pending state, including those previously returned asPAIDorPARTIALLY_PAID.
- InvoiceStatus enum. Added the
- Payments API
- ListPayment. The endpoint now supports the
limitparameter.
- ListPayment. The endpoint now supports the
- Refunds API
- ListPaymentRefunds. The endpoint now supports the
limitparameter.
- ListPaymentRefunds. The endpoint now supports the
- DeviceDetails. The object now includes the
device_installation_idfield.
Documentation updates
- Payment status. Added details about the
Payment.statuschanges and how the status relates to the seller receiving the funds. - Refund status. Added details about the
PaymentRefund.statuschanges and how the status relates to the cardholder receiving the funds. - CreateRefund errors. Added documentation for the
REFUND_DECLINEDerror code.